интегрирует алгоритм в обработчик кнопки
This commit is contained in:
parent
878a1f2657
commit
bc0d2385f7
13
MainForm.cs
13
MainForm.cs
@ -19,6 +19,19 @@ namespace AwesomeEmailExtractor
|
|||||||
|
|
||||||
private void executeButton_Click(object sender, EventArgs e)
|
private void executeButton_Click(object sender, EventArgs e)
|
||||||
{
|
{
|
||||||
|
// Объявляем список уникальных e-mail-ов
|
||||||
|
List<string> uniqueEmails = new List<string>();
|
||||||
|
|
||||||
|
// Получаем исходный текст из sourceRichTextBox
|
||||||
|
string sourceText = sourceRichTextBox.Text;
|
||||||
|
|
||||||
|
// Вызываем метод для извлечения e-mail-ов
|
||||||
|
int count = ExtactEmailsAlgorithm.Extract(sourceText, out uniqueEmails);
|
||||||
|
|
||||||
|
// Выводим результат
|
||||||
|
toolStripStatusLabel.Text = "Успех!";
|
||||||
|
label1.Text = $"Количество e-mail-ов в тексте: {count}";
|
||||||
|
uniqueListBox.DataSource = uniqueEmails;
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user